MAJIC 2025-2026 Application
MAJIC: Muslims and Jews Inspiring Change is the High School Leadership Council of NewGround: A Muslim-Jewish Partnership for Change. This leadership training program offers a select group of Muslim and Jewish high school students the opportunity to build communication skills and conflict literacy, create lasting relationships across faith boundaries and have an impact on the climate of community relations in Los Angeles and beyond. With discourse on university campuses more polarized than ever, these skills are crucial for students to become effective leaders among their peers. 

A diverse cohort of 20-24 Muslim and Jewish teenagers will be selected to participate in an intensive academic year experience including several Sunday retreats and several half-day Sunday sessions. Students will learn from a variety of communal leaders and from one another about the Jewish and Muslim worlds as well as issues impacting both communities. Upon completion of the program, MAJICians will receive a certificate from the City of Los Angeles in appreciation of their willingness to learn together, engage in difficult conversations and contribute to improving inter-group relations in LA.

We are interested in applicants with demonstrated leadership skills who will also grow through our program. We accept applications from and nominations for students entering 10th-12th grades for the 2025-26 school year. Students of high school age who have started Community College are also encouraged to apply.

Tuition is $2,250 per student. The cost for the program is $3500 per student and is partially underwritten by grants and donations. Tuition can be paid in monthly installments at a level comfortable for you.
